Local Tradesperson highlights low wages for new Amazon field jobs
The Regular Town Council Meeting held on May 8, 2025, in Prescott Valley, Arizona, addressed several key issues impacting the local community, particularly in relation to employment opportunities and economic development.

The meeting began with a discussion on the current job market in the area, highlighting challenges faced by residents in securing well-paying positions. A speaker, who has extensive experience in the building trades and various administrative roles, expressed concerns about the limited availability of high-paying jobs, particularly for specialized positions. The speaker noted that many positions related to the upcoming Amazon facility are offering wages around $22 per hour, which may not meet the financial needs of local workers.

Following this, the council reviewed plans for the Amazon facility, emphasizing its potential impact on job creation in Prescott Valley. The council members discussed strategies to attract more businesses to the area, aiming to enhance employment opportunities for residents.

The meeting concluded with a commitment from the council to continue exploring ways to improve the local job market and support residents in finding better employment options.
